The Influence of 9/11 on the Travel Experience

As a nexus of policy, memory, and speculation, 9/11 has indelibly influenced the travel experience. Not only did it reshape airport security and the way we navigate air travel, but it also transformed destinations like Ground Zero into places of pilgrimage. The desire to understand and personally connect with the historical events of that day continues to draw individuals from around the world to New York City, signifying a universal quest for understanding and remembrance. The need to not only travel but to journey through history is a reminder of how interconnected our global society has become.
